Screening of maize germplasm through antiobiosis mechanism of resistance against Chilo partellus (Swinhoe)

Pratap Divekar, Pradyumn Kumar and Suby SB

Ten different maize germplasm were evaluated for their relative resistance to maize stem borer Chilo partellus (Swinhoe). Several biological parameters of C. partellus viz., larval and pupal survival, larval and pupal recovery, larval and pupal weights and percent pupation and plant parameter i.e. leaf injury rating (1-9) were used to study the germplasm susceptibility level. Larval weight (10th, 18th and 25th Days after Artificial Infestation) and pupal weights were significantly lower on the germplasm viz., BML-7 and HKI-323 as compared to the germplasm namely, HKI-1128 and HKI-193-1 indicating the germplasm susceptibility level. The pupae obtained from the relatively resistant germplasm were found deformed with lower weight indicates maximum antibiosis resulted from rearing the larvae on resistant germplasm. The adverse effects on biological parameters were found more pronounced in larval and pupal weight, and larval survival and percent pupation of C. partellus. Relatively higher percent pupation and larval survival were observed on highly susceptible germplasm HKI-1128 and HKI-193-1 as compared to resistant ones BML-7 and HKI-323.
